Subject: [PATCH v16 38/45] KVM: arm64: CCA: Propagate breakpoint and watchpoint counts to userspace

From: Jean-Philippe Brucker <jean-philippe@linaro.org>

The RMM describes the maximum number of BPs/WPs available to the guest
in the Feature Register 0. Propagate those numbers into ID_AA64DFR0_EL1,
which is visible to userspace. A VMM needs this information in order to
set up realm parameters.

---
 arch/arm64/include/asm/kvm_rmi.h |  2 ++
 arch/arm64/kvm/rmi.c             | 19 +++++++++++++++++++
 arch/arm64/kvm/sys_regs.c        |  3 +++
 3 files changed, 24 insertions(+)

diff --git a/arch/arm64/include/asm/kvm_rmi.h b/arch/arm64/include/asm/kvm_rmi.h
index 13933f0e555d..7d27c17276bf 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/include/asm/kvm_rmi.h
+++ b/arch/arm64/include/asm/kvm_rmi.h
@@ -98,6 +98,8 @@ struct realm_rec {
 void kvm_init_rmi(void);
 u32 kvm_rmm_ipa_limit(void);
 
+u64 kvm_realm_reset_id_aa64dfr0_el1(const stru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u, u64 val);
+
 bool kvm_rmi_supports_sve(void);
 
 int kvm_init_realm(struct kvm *kvm);
diff --git a/arch/arm64/kvm/rmi.c b/arch/arm64/kvm/rmi.c
index 0d46768022df..de893308148e 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/kvm/rmi.c
+++ b/arch/arm64/kvm/rmi.c
@@ -36,6 +36,25 @@ u32 kvm_rmm_ipa_limit(void)
 	return u64_get_bits(rmi_feat_reg(0), RMI_FEATURE_REGISTER_0_S2SZ);
 }
 
+u64 kvm_realm_reset_id_aa64dfr0_el1(const stru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u, u64 val)
+{
+	u32 bps = u64_get_bits(rmi_feat_reg(0), RMI_FEATURE_REGISTER_0_NUM_BPS);
+	u32 wps = u64_get_bits(rmi_feat_reg(0), RMI_FEATURE_REGISTER_0_NUM_WPS);
+	u32 ctx_cmps;
+
+	/* Ensure CTX_CMPs is still valid */
+	ctx_cmps = FIELD_GET(ID_AA64DFR0_EL1_CTX_CMPs, val);
+	ctx_cmps = min(bps, ctx_cmps);
+
+	val &= ~(ID_AA64DFR0_EL1_BRPs_MASK | ID_AA64DFR0_EL1_WRPs_MASK |
+		 ID_AA64DFR0_EL1_CTX_CMPs);
+	val |= FIELD_PREP(ID_AA64DFR0_EL1_BRPs_MASK, bps) |
+	       FIELD_PREP(ID_AA64DFR0_EL1_WRPs_MASK, wps) |
+	       FIELD_PREP(ID_AA64DFR0_EL1_CTX_CMPs, ctx_cmps);
+
+	return val;
+}
+
 static int get_start_level(struct realm *realm)
 {
 	return 4 - stage2_pgtable_levels(realm->ia_bits);
diff --git a/arch/arm64/kvm/sys_regs.c b/arch/arm64/kvm/sys_regs.c
index 5d5c579d4579..e0fe9f2562bc 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/kvm/sys_regs.c
+++ b/arch/arm64/kvm/sys_regs.c
@@ -2142,6 +2142,9 @@ static u64 sanitise_id_aa64dfr0_el1(const stru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u, u64 val)
 	/* Hide BRBE from guests */
 	val &= ~ID_AA64DFR0_EL1_BRBE_MASK;
 
+	if (vcpu_is_rec(vcpu))
+		return kvm_realm_reset_id_aa64dfr0_el1(vcpu, val);
+
 	return val;
 }
